GOLDEN, Colo. -- A jury is deliberating the fate of a former Dakota Ridge High School teacher accused of having sex with a student.Kevin Ponis, 36, testified in his defense Friday, saying he thought the student was 18, because she told him she was. Because the relationship appears consensual, the girl's age during the 2000 and 2001 sexual encounters is crucial.
The teenager testified last week that she had developed a crush on Ponis, and looked up to him and during one point, he had told her, "Think of me as a big brother. I will always be there for you."Ponis faces charges in Jefferson County of sexual assault on a child by a person in a position of trust, and a pattern of sexual assault on a child by a person in a position of trust -- 10 counts in all.Testimony revealed the former tennis coach had sex with at least two other students, who were 18 years old, and the sex was therefore not a crime.The prosecution claims Ponis violated his position of trust as a teacher, coach and student government sponsor to prey on his students.The jury got the case late Friday afternoon and deliberated all day Monday before adjourning for the evening. They'll resume deliberations Tuesday morning.Ponis could face up to 32 years in prison if convicted on all counts.
